India's 5 Trillion Economy India's target to reach a $5 trillion economy was originally set for the year 2024-25 by the Indian government. However, achieving this target has become more challenging due to the global economic slowdown and the impact of the COVID-19 pandemic on the Indian economy. To achieve this target, India needs to maintain a sustained annual growth rate of around 8-9% over the next few years. This requires significant structural reforms and investments in key sectors such as infrastructure, education, and healthcare, as well as attracting more foreign investment. Some of the measures taken by the Indian government to achieve this target include the introduction of various economic reforms such as the Goods and Services Tax (GST) and the Insolvency and Bankruptcy Code (IBC), as well as initiatives like Make in India, Digital India, and Skill India.
